Establishing the involvement of the novel gene AGBL5 in retinitis pigmentosa by whole genome sequencing.
Physiological genomics - 1 Dec 2016
Branham Kari, Matsui Hiroko, Biswas Pooja, Guru Aditya A, Hicks Michael, Suk John J, Li He, Jakubosky David, Long Tao, Telenti Amalio, Nariai Naoki, Heckenlively John R, Frazer Kelly A, Sieving Paul A, Ayyagari Radha
Abstract excerpt
While more than 250 genes are known to cause inherited retinal degenerations (IRD), nearly 40-50% of families have the genetic basis for their disease unknown. In this study we sought to identify the underlying cause of IRD in a family by whole genome sequence (WGS) analysis.
